Sudan is a country located in northeastern Africa. It is bordered by Egypt to the north, the Red Sea to the northeast, Eritrea and Ethiopia to the east, South Sudan to the south, the Central African Republic to the west, and Libya to the northwest. Sudan has a population of over 43 million people and its capital and largest city are Khartoum.
The official language is Arabic and the currency is the Sudanese pound. Sudan has a diverse culture and a rich history, with influences from ancient civilizations such as the Kingdom of Kush and the Nubian culture. The country is known for its natural landscapes, including the Nile River and the Sahara Desert. However, it’s worth noting that Sudan has gone through a lot of political turmoil in recent years, and it is not currently considered safe for tourists to travel to.
